Cities and metropolitan areas of the United States
This article includes information about the 100 most populous incorporated cities, the 100 most populous core-based statistical areas, and the 100 most populous primary statistical areas of the United States and Puerto Rico. This information is displayed in two tables. The first table ranks the cities, CBSAs, and PSAs separately by population. The second table displays the areas in hierarchical order by the most populous PSA, then most populous CBSA, and then most populous city.... Read more
